During an examination, the nurse can assess mental status by which

activity? - ANSWER ✔✔Observing the patient and inferring health or

dysfunction

The nurse is assessing a 75-year-old man. As the nurse begins the

mental status portion of the assessment, the nurse expects that this

patient: - ANSWER ✔✔May take a little longer to respond, but his

general knowledge and abilities should not have declined.

,When assessing aging adults, the nurse knows that one of the first

things that should be assessed before making judgments about their

mental status is: - ANSWER ✔✔Sensory perceptive abilities


The nurse is preparing to conduct a mental status examination. Which

statement is true regarding the mental status examination? -

ANSWER ✔✔Gathering mental status information during the health

history interview is usually sufficient.

A woman brings her husband to the clinic for an examination. She is

particularly worried because after a recent fall, he seems to have lost a

great deal of his memory of recent events. Which statement reflects the

nurses best course of action? - ANSWER ✔✔Perform a complete

mental status examination.

A patient is admitted to the unit after an automobile accident. The nurse

begins the mental status examination and finds that the patient has

dysarthric speech and is lethargic. The nurses best approach regarding

this examination is to: - ANSWER ✔✔Plan to defer the rest of the

mental status examination.

A 19-year-old woman comes to the clinic at the insistence of her brother.

She is wearing black combat boots and a black lace nightgown over the

top of her other clothes. Her hair is dyed pink with black streaks

, throughout. She has several pierced holes in her nares and ears and is

wearing an earring through her eyebrow and heavy black makeup. The

nurse concludes that: - ANSWER ✔✔More information should be

gathered to decide whether her dress is appropriate.

During a mental status examination, the nurse wants to assess a

patients affect. The nurse should ask the patient which question? -

ANSWER ✔✔How do you feel today?


The nurse is planning to assess new memory with a patient. The best

way for the nurse to do this would be - ANSWER ✔✔Give him the

Four Unrelated Words Test.

When reviewing the use of alcohol by older adults, the nurse notes that

older adults have several characteristics that can increase the risk of

alcohol use. Which would increase the bioavailability of alcohol in the

blood for longer periods in the older adult? - ANSWER ✔✔Decreased

liver and kidney functioning
